#dde0b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dde0bb is composed of 86.7% red, 87.8%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 64.9 degrees, a saturation of 37.4% and a lightness of 80.6%. #dde0b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bbc177.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#dde0b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0d06 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dde0b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d0d1ca is the less saturated color, while #f7fe9d is the most saturated one.
